Kinds Of Sedation Options
When it comes to picking the right sedation option for your dental treatment, you'll locate a number of techniques customized to different demands and choices. One of the most common kinds are laughing gas, oral sedation, and IV sedation.
Laughing gas, also called chuckling gas, is a preferred choice for several clients. It's breathed in via a mask, supplying a soothing result while permitting you to continue to be awake and responsive. The results wear away quickly, so you can drive yourself home later.
Oral sedation involves taking a suggested drug before your visit. This choice can vary from moderate to moderate sedation, depending upon the dosage. IV sedation offers much deeper relaxation and enables your dental practitioner to readjust the sedation degree during the treatment. This approach is excellent for longer or much more complex therapies. You'll likely remain in a semi-conscious state and will certainly require a person to drive you home later.
Each choice has its benefits, so discussing your choices and interest in your dentist will assist you make the best option for your demands.
Planning for Your Appointment
Getting ready for your dental visit entails a couple of vital actions to make sure a smooth experience. Initially, verify your consultation time and day. It is necessary to show up on schedule to prevent any delays.
Next off, review any kind of drugs you're currently taking with your dental professional ahead of time. This consists of over-the-counter medications and supplements, as they might affect your sedation choices.
If you're having sedation dental care, your dental expert will likely give specific instructions. You might require to avoid eating or drinking for a specific duration before your consultation. Adhere to these guidelines closely to guarantee your security.
